Action item PM-042: WebSocket compression tradeoffs

Owner: release management. Following the Brindlemark outage, we must document when permessage-deflate should be disabled, since compression amplified memory pressure on the gateway nodes under reconnect storms. Deliverable: a decision table covering payload sizes, client mix, and CPU headroom. The draft analysis and benchmark data are collected on the internal page below.

dashboard of kafop-yagep = https://jira.zemvarsys.internal/pages/pages/pages/display/cc87

Subject: Handover — fan-out backpressure

Keld,

Notifier fan-out hit backpressure twice this shift. Queue depth capped by the Throttlegate patch; no message loss, but delivery lag peaked at 9 minutes. Security note for the reviewer: rate-limit overrides were used, all logged. Audit trail is in the Throttlegate console. Questions on the override process go to this address.

escalation mailbox, hahag-yagaf: ralir@paliqhq.test

Subject: Basement archive access this week

Hi all,

The archive room under the Penfold Wing is back in use after the shelving repairs. Team assistants collecting contract boxes should sign the register at the front desk first and return keys by 5pm. The keypad on the archive door has been reset, and the new entry code is below.

turnstile pass: bdg-QZV-3

Management Meeting Minutes — Brightline Series Pricing

Attendees: senior management, finance liaison.

Quick session on the Brightline kettle range. Margins are thinning thanks to material costs, so we agreed to nudge retail prices up 3% from next quarter. Promo pricing stays for the Marlow outlet stores. Finance to model the revenue impact by Thursday. Context for the decision sits in the confidential note below.

management briefing: Project Ulavan slips by two quarters because of the staffing delay.